Dryer

A dryer is a household appliance that uses heat to remove moisture from wet clothes and fabrics. It’s designed to complement the washing machine, as it allows you to dry your clothes quickly and effectively. 

The process of using the dryer is straightforward, and it usually involves loading the clothes in the drum, setting the temperature and time, and turning the machine on. The heat generated by the dryer evaporates the moisture, and the airflow carries the water out.

There are two main types of dryers in the market: electric and gas dryers. Electric dryers use electricity to heat the air, while gas dryers use natural gas to generate heat. Both types have their advantages and disadvantages, but the choice ultimately depends on what’s available in your area, your budget, and personal preference.

Ironing Board

An ironing board is a flat surface that is covered with a heat-resistant fabric and is suspended on adjustable legs for easy adjustment of height. It is used to provide an even surface for ironing clothes and eliminate wrinkles. 

Most ironing boards come with a built-in iron rest that is placed on one end of the board for holding the iron when not in use. Some ironing boards come with a sleeve board, a narrow board that is designed to fit inside shirt sleeves, and pant legs.

Ironing boards come in various sizes and shapes, with some being designed for specific tasks. A standard ironing board measures around 15 to 18 inches in width and 4 feet in length. However, compact models are also available for those with limited space. Wall-mounted ironing boards are also popular options that can save valuable floor space.

Laundry Detergent

Laundry detergent is a product made up of a combination of chemicals, enzymes, and surfactants designed to break down and remove dirt, stains, and grime from clothes. These cleaning agents work together to make sure that clothes come out of the wash looking and smelling fresh.

Laundry detergent works by loosening dirt and stains from fabric fibers and suspending them in the water. The surfactant molecules in the detergent lower the surface tension of the water, allowing it to penetrate the fabric more easily. Once the dirt is lifted from the fibers, it is held in suspension in the water until it is rinsed away.

Stain Removers

Stain removers are cleaning solutions or products designed specifically to target and remove stubborn stains from fabrics. They come in different forms like sprays, gels, powders, and liquids that you can apply to the stain before washing. 

Most stain removers contain enzymes that break down protein-based stains like blood, grass, and wine. Some also use solvents to remove oil-based stains like grease, paint, and lipstick. There are many laundry stain removers available in the market today, and some of the most popular ones include shout, OxiClean, stain-X, and Zout.

Fabric Softener

Fabric softener is a liquid product added to the washing machine or dryer, which helps reduce static, soften clothes, and make them smell fresh. It contains conditioning agents that bond to the fabric fibers easily, making them soft, fluffy and easy to handle. 

The most common conditioning agents used in fabric conditioners are quaternary ammonium compounds, silicones, and natural fats like tallow.

Laundry Brush

A laundry brush is a tool used to remove stubborn stains and dirt from clothes before tossing them into the washing machine. It comes in various shapes, sizes, and materials, but most commonly, it’s made of plastic or wooden bristles with a handle for easy grip. 

Having a laundry brush in your laundry area can help you tackle common laundry problems such as grass stains, food stains, mud stains, and more.

The laundry brush is not just for removing stains; it can also extend the life of your clothes. By using a laundry brush to remove dirt and buildup from your clothes before washing, you can prevent wear and tear on your clothes caused by repeated washing with harsh detergents. 

Additionally, using a laundry brush can help you save money by reducing the need to replace clothes frequently due to damage caused by over-washing.

When it comes to selecting a laundry brush, there are a few things to keep in mind. First, consider the type of bristles you want. Soft bristles are suitable for delicate fabrics, while stiff bristles are more effective for tough stains.

Second, think about the size of the brush. A larger brush may be more effective in removing stains on larger garments, while a smaller brush may be more suitable for small and delicate items like baby clothes.

Using a laundry brush is easy, and the process is quite simple. Wet the brush with water and soap, then gently scrub the stained area in a circular motion until the stain is gone. Rinse the brush with water and soap after use, and let it dry thoroughly before storing it. Make sure to avoid using bleach or harsh chemicals with your brush, as these can damage the bristles.
